The Compensation Model

Bone-Snapper Primis Edition

As a very small, independent company working on a shoestring budget, we don’t have the deep pockets we wish we did. So we’re unable to pay everyone right up front for the right to license your art. But, we do have a model we think you’ll like.

For every piece of art we license from you, you are issued a share in our profit sharing at Nimue Innovation Studios. Each share can earn a percentage of the profit-sharing when we issue dividends. And we are hoping to do a lot of profit-sharing with the artists. Whenever we do a payout, artists will receive a percentage of that bucket of money based on the percentage of issued shares they own. If there were 100 shares issued and you had 5 of them, you’d receive 5% of the total profit-sharing amount. We promise to share at least 50% of the profits with artists when we do this.

We want to ensure that we recognize the people who took a chance on a small start-up. This is part of how we’re working hard to create a model where rising tides do lift all boats. We’re not in this to get rich, but to build a company that makes sense and helps more than just the founders.

The License

Gentle Reminder Primis Edition

The license we offer only allows us to use your art in the context of the overall card art. So all other rights for digital downloads, mouse pads, posters, shower curtains, bath mats – whatever you can think of – stay with you. So if a card is very popular, you can still benefit from owning the rights to the original artwork. We might print oversized versions of cards and such, but we will never use your art by itself – only with the rest of the card art.

We do need a signed license agreement before we will include your art in the game. We’ll be sure to send that to you for your review. We want you to be confident in our process and can talk you through every step. It may not be for every artist, but this model has been used before very successfully (ever heard of a small, niche game called Magic: the Gathering?).

If you don’t feel comfortable or confident selling the art on your own, we can work with you to sell it through our online store and give you all of the profits from the sale. We are willing to work with our artists to make sure you’re properly compensated. We appreciate your trust in us and for taking a chance on a new game from a new company.
